Background
The server needs to perform acoustic characteristic test on the noise test box after manufacturing, and in the test process, a plurality of acoustic probes need to be arranged on an envelope spherical surface taking a sound source as a center and face a sound source, so that the distances between all the acoustic probes and the sound source are the same, and the acoustic signal values acquired by the acoustic probes are the same, so that the accuracy of test data can be ensured.
the size of the sound power test support of the existing server is fixed, the sound power of the server with the general size can only be tested, the size of the server is increased along with the improvement of the existing storage requirement, and for the 8U-height server and the large-capacity storage, the existing sound power test support cannot guarantee the distance between a sound probe and the test server, so that the sound power test is inaccurate.

As shown in fig. 1 and 2, a test support for server acoustic power includes an upper connection ring 5 and arc-shaped support rods 6, the arc-shaped support rods 6 are circumferentially distributed along the upper connection ring 5, each arc-shaped support rod 6 is provided with two first connection pieces 3, the upper connection ring 5 is provided with a second connection piece 4, the first connection pieces 3 and the second connection pieces 4 are provided with adjusting rods 2 for fixing acoustic probes, the lower ends of all the arc-shaped support rods 6 are connected through a lower connection ring 1, the lower connection ring 1 is provided with an opening 101, a tested server can be pushed into the test support from the opening, the problem that the support needs to be lifted and covered on the server at present is solved, manpower is saved, and the use is safer and more convenient; the lower extreme of lower connecting ring 101 is equipped with universal wheel 7 and supporting leg 8, and universal wheel 7 all becomes triangular distribution with supporting leg 8, and universal wheel 7 and the even interval distribution of supporting leg 8 promptly.
The arc-shaped support rod and the upper connecting ring are both provided with adjusting rods, the distance from the sound source can be adjusted through the adjusting rods, so that the distance of the acoustic probe can be adjusted according to the size of the detected server, acoustic detection is performed on the servers with different sizes, the detection distance meets the acoustic detection requirement, and the universality of the test support is improved; and the lower extreme of arc bracing piece is connected through lower go-between, has guaranteed the stability of support, has ensured that the arc bracing piece can be located same detection sphere, has improved and has detected the precision.
As shown in fig. 5, the side walls of the adjusting rods 2 are uniformly provided with scale marks 201, and the adjusting positions of the adjusting rods can be ensured to be the same through the scale marks, so that the distances from the acoustic probe to the sound source are ensured to be the same, and the adjusting precision and the accuracy of the test result are improved.
As shown in fig. 5 and 6, the first connecting member 3 includes a sliding sleeve 301 and a first fixing sleeve 302, the sliding sleeve 301 has elasticity, the sliding sleeve 301 is tightly sleeved outside the arc-shaped support rod 6, the fixing firmness is ensured, and the sliding sleeve can slide at the same time, so as to adjust the position of the first connecting member on the arc-shaped support rod, facilitate adjustment, facilitate use, and a first fixing sleeve 302 is arranged on the side wall of the sliding sleeve 301, the first fixing sleeve 302 is matched with the adjusting rod 2, and a first bolt 303 for fixing the adjusting rod 2 is arranged on the side wall of the first fixing sleeve 302.
As shown in fig. 3, the second connecting member 4 includes a connecting rod 401 and a second fixing sleeve 404, the connecting rod 401 is connected to the upper end of the upper connecting ring 5, the second fixing sleeve 404 is disposed at the end of the connecting rod 401, as shown in fig. 4, the second fixing sleeve 404 is disposed right above the upper connecting ring 5, the second fixing sleeve 404 is engaged with the adjusting rod 2, and a second bolt 405 for fixing the adjusting rod 2 is disposed on the side wall of the second fixing sleeve 404.
In order to facilitate adjustment and improve accuracy of a test result, the method is more accurate. As shown in fig. 6, a first supporting plate 304 is disposed on a side wall of the first fixing sleeve 302, and a first indicating plate 305 for indicating a scale is disposed on the first supporting plate 304; as shown in fig. 3, a second support plate 402 is disposed on the connection rod 401, and a second indication plate 403 for indicating scales is disposed on the second support plate 402.
As shown in fig. 7, the supporting leg 8 includes a threaded rod 801 and a sleeve 802, the upper end of the threaded rod 801 is connected with the lower end of the lower connecting ring 1, the lower end of the threaded rod 801 is in threaded fit with the upper end of the sleeve 802, the lower end of the sleeve 802 is provided with a supporting block 803, the height of the supporting leg can be adjusted through the fit between the sleeve and the threaded rod, the adjustment is simple and convenient, when the test is performed, the stability and the position fixity of the support can be guaranteed only through the supporting leg support, and the measurement precision is guaranteed.
During the use, promote the test support, make test server enter into inside the support from opening 101, and be located the central authorities of support, then rotate sleeve 802, make the universal wheel keep away from ground, support the support through supporting leg 8, prevent to slide, adjust the position of first connecting piece 3 on arc bracing piece 6 through pulling sliding sleeve 301, then adjust the position of pole, according to the size of server, set up the distance of adjusting pole 2 apart from the service, confirm after the distance, will adjust pole 2 through first bolt and second bolt and screw up fixedly, it is the same to utilize the scale mark 201 on adjusting pole 2 to ensure that the fixed position of every regulation pole is the same, then fix the same scale mark department on adjusting pole 2 with the sound probe, test. After the test is finished, the sleeve 802 is rotated to enable the universal wheel 7 to be supported on the ground and push the support away.
